These procedures are for immediate application by SC21, without requiring
explicit modification of the Directives by JTC1. The procedures outlined
in SC21 N10668, "Proposal for a new procedure for the maintenance of
mature standards", are an extension of these procedures whose approval
will require future action by JTC1. The word "interim" to describe the
procedures below anticipates their replacement by those outlined in SC21
N10668.=20

Scope

These maintenance procedures apply to the standards identified in table A
(which list may be modified by resolution of SC21). These are mature
standards in the OSI area that are directly implementable by users. These
procedures are an adaptation of the procedures specified in JTC1
Directives (see 14.4.3 to 14.4.10).=20

The maintenance activities are limited to the resolution of technical
defects, i.e. technical errors or ambiguities in an IS inadvertently
introduced either in drafting or printing which could lead to an incorrect
or unsafe application of the IS. Technical changes or extensions to the
standards are excluded from the scope.=20

For SC21 standards that are not included in table A, the submission and
processing of defect reports is as specified in the JTC1 Directives (see
14.4).=20


Maintenance Group The Maintenance Group shall consist of a Maintenance
Secretariat, a Maintenance Rapporteur, and, for each standard or group of
standards listed in table A, an Editing Group.=20

The Maintenance Secretariat shall assume the responsibilities in relation
to defect processing for the identified standards that are assigned to the
WG Secretariat in the JTC1 Directives 14.4, as modified by these
procedures.=20

The Maintenance Rapporteur shall be a member of each Editing Group, and
shall take the technical lead in creating consensus and developing a
resolution to reported defects where necessary. The Maintenance Rapporteur
shall defer to the Project/Defect editor for a standard where there is
one.=20

Editing Group

If an editing group, as specified in JTC1 Directives 14.4.4, has been
established for a standard and a Project/defect editor has been appointed,
that group shall continue to operate, and shall include the Maintenance
Rapporteur and any other experts nominated in the future by NBs In
addition, the editor and the Maintenance Rapporteur, in consultation with
the Maintenance Secretariat, shall have power to co-opt additional experts
to the group. Co-opted experts shall have technical competence in the
standard in question, but need not be appointed by, or have any
affiliation with any NB or LO.=20

Where there is no project/defect editor, the Maintenance Rapporteur shall
act as defect editor, and in consultation with the Maintenance
Secretariat, shall have power to co-opt experts to form an editing group.=
=20

The editing group shall operate by electronic mail, and, when possible, by
World-Wide Web/ftp server. Members of the group are expected to respond to
requests for comment or input in a timely manner.=20

NOTES=20

1 -- It is assumed that all members of the group have access to
email and Web facilitites. =20

2 - The name "editing group" is somewhat of a misnomer, since the group do
not directly edit the Standard, but is retained to align with JTC1
Directives 14.4. =20

Defect Reports - submission

A defect report may be submitted as specified in JTC1 Directives 14.4.4 to
the Maintenance Secretariat. However, a member of an editing group who has
not been nominated by an NB shall not submit a defect report direct to the
Maintenance Secretariat but will go via the Maintenance Rapporteur.=20

In addition, any person, with or without any affiliation to an NB, (and
including co-opted members of the editing group) may draw the attention of
the Maintenance Rapporteur to an apparent problem. If appropriate, the
Maintenance Rapporteur (or the defect editor, if there is one) shall draft
this as a defect report, and shall submit it to the Maintenance
Secretariat. The Maintenance Rapporteur (or editor) may discuss the issue
with the editing group prior to determining whether the apparent problem
is worth progressing as a defect report.=20

Defect Reports - distribution

The Maintenance Rapporteur shall make the defect report available to the
editing group, either by email, or by placing on web/ftp server, and
notifying the group.=20

The Maintenance Secretariat shall notify the SC Secretariat and SC21
NBLOSs of receipt of the defect report (and other changes to the web
pages). SC21 NBLOs may obtain copies of the defect reports on request to
the Maintenance Secretariat.=20

Defect reports - Preparation of response

 After discussion on the email list, the Rapporteur, or defect editor,
shall draft one of the possible responses as specified in JTC1 Directives
14.4.8. (Draft Technical Corrigendum, or lesser response) and send this to
the Maintenance Secretariat.=20

The response, including any proposed changes to the standard, shall added
to the web pages.=20

Processing of response

If no change is proposed, there is no further action except for the
report-back (see below)=20

If further consideration is required, i.e. the editing group consider the
resolution of the defect would require a substantial change in the
standard, the response shall document the issues involved. The Maintenance
Secretariat shall submit this response to the SC21 Secretariat for SC
circulation.  No further action is required from the Maintenance group.=20

NOTE - The initiative and responsibility for any additional work pass to
the SC and may involve a JTC1 NP ballot, if there was appropriate support.=
=20

If the response results in the correction of an editorial defect, no
immediate further action is taken (apart from placing the response and the
correction on the web pages) until a technical corrigendum is approved for
the standard. At that time the editorial correction is included in the
technical corrigendum for publication.=20

If the response proposes a technical corrigendum, the circulation and
ballot procedures in 14.4.9.4 shall apply, with the following
modification:=20

the letter ballot shall request that if comments are made by an NB
(including JTC1 P- members that are not P-members of the SC) that they
also identify experts who can join the editing group (if they are not
already members)=20

Reporting

The Maintenance Secretariat and Rapporteur shall submit a report to the SC
Secretariat before each plenary meeting of the SC. The report shall list
the actions taken on all defect reports current or progressed since the
previous report and shall contain the defect report indexes for the
standards assigned to the Maintenance Group.=20
